The Copa del Rey It is one of his oldest tournaments football history: Began playing in 1903 with only two interruptions, in 1937 and 1938.

14 clubs from Spain they managed to win this trophy that had various names by reclaiming its name Spanish Championship – His Majesty’s Cup in the 1976-1977 season.

In 2022, Real Betis Football beat it Valencia Football Club to win the trophy 120th edition at the La Cartuja stadium, in Seville. For the béticos it was their third sanctification.

In 2023, meanwhile, there will be a different champion: Real Madrid and Osasuna will decide the crown on the same platform in Seville.

Aston Villa win 11 games in a row for the first time since 1914

The English football club Aston Villa won 11 consecutive victories for the first time since 1914 and repeated the club record for this indicator.

On Saturday, in the away match of the 18th round of the English championship, the Birmingham team beat London’s Chelsea (2:1).

The last time Aston Villa won 11 matches in a row was in 1914. This happened previously in 1897.

Aston Villa under the leadership of former Spartak Moscow coach Unai Emery he achieved 8 victories in the English championship and 3 in the Europa League.

In the English championship standings Aston Villa is in 3rd place with 39 points. In the next round, the Birmingham team will play away against Arsenal, leaders of the Premier League (42 points).
